How they compare

Annex I countries currently reports 54.14 kt against 7.26 kt in Côte d'Ivoire, a difference of 46.88 kt.

That makes Annex I countries's figure about 7.5 times Côte d'Ivoire's.

The two have swapped places 6 times across 34 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Annex I countries ahead.

Annex I countries ranks 17th and Côte d'Ivoire ranks 18th of 32 groups.

Across the 4 decades both report, Annex I countries averaged higher in 2 and Côte d'Ivoire in 2.

The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ions disseminated in the FAOSTAT Climate Change domains of emissions from agrifood systems. Data are computed following the Tier 1 methods of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Emissions from other economic sectors as defined by the IPCC are also disseminated in the domain for completeness.
